There are ten tweaks on this page. (Yes, there ultimately need to be a few 
more… but it’s a testament to how awesome Lilypond is that it looks like this 
with only ten small manual adjustments!)

Leveraging the edition engraver, I have removed those tweaks from the content — 
where they were embedded using a frustratingly complex system of tags — and put 
them in the presentation file where they belong; the presentation files for the 
other five standard outputs (i.e., Full Score, Piano/Conductor Score, Piano 
Part, Percussion Part, and Bass Part) will, of course, have their own set of 
tweaks.

Finally, a way to truly separate content from presentation.
